WebJul 14, 2024 · How to spell certain words can be tricky, but here are a few general rules that apply to English words. All words have a vowel (a, e, i, o, u, or y in vowel form). A Q is always followed by a u. C can have a /k/ or /s/ sound as in cat or cite. G can have a /g/ or /j/ sound as in garage or the name Gerry. Words with just one vowel will have ... Summary. Is it whiney or whiny? Whiney and whiny are two ways to spell the same adjective, which means always complaining. Whiney is the wrong way to spell this word. Whiny is the right way.
